Tesseract and Beyond: Exploring Higher Dimensional Spaces
The concept of dimensionality extends beyond our everyday perception of three spatial dimensions. While we navigate a world defined by length, width, and height, mathematicians and physicists delve into realms of four or even higher dimensions. The tesseract, a four-dimensional cube, serves as a remarkable example of this, offering glimpses into unimaginable spatial configurations.
Visualizing these higher dimensions yields a significant challenge, as our brains are hardwired to process only three. Yet, abstract models and simulations permit us to understand the intricacies of these multidimensional spaces.
